Baby nanny role in Winchester SO21
This is a lovely opportunity to join a busy, professional family caring for their baby girl, who will be 6 months old when the position begins. The family are looking for an experienced, qualified nanny to work Monday to Friday, 1:00pm-7:00pm (30 hours per week).
They are seeking someone with a Montessori-inspired approach to childcare-someone who encourages independence, learns through play and exploration, and supports their daughter's development in a calm, nurturing and engaging way. They are looking for a nanny who is proactive, genuinely invested in their little girl, and who will become a valued part of the family.
Mum works from home full-time, and Dad splits his time between home and the office. When they are at home, they are very much working, so the nanny will have sole charge of their daughter during working hours. They are therefore looking for someone confident, capable and happy to take full responsibility for her care and daily routine.
Both parents enjoy an active lifestyle, love food and travelling, and are looking for a nanny who will provide a fun, stimulating and enriching environment. Duties will include following the baby's routine, attending classes and groups, enjoying walks, and encouraging age-appropriate developmental milestones through play and everyday experiences.
In addition to childcare, there will be some light housekeeping duties to help keep on top of the home (the family employ a cleaner), along with preparing family meals, occasional cooking, and walking the family dog. However, the little girl's care and wellbeing will always be the priority.
The nanny will need to be a driver to commute to the family home. An automatic nanny car will be provided for use during working hours.
